#2 Cyrano de Bergerac

Extension: PDF | 430 pages

Cyrano de Bergerac by Edmond Rostand is a play about unrequited love and the power of inner beauty over physical appearance. It explores themes of sacrifice, deception, and the tragic consequences of hidden emotions, making it a compelling exploration of forbidden love.

#3 Wuthering Heights

Extension: PDF | 548 pages

Wuthering Heights by Emily Bronte explores the destructive power of passionate, forbidden love. This classic novel depicts the intense, all-consuming relationship between Catherine Earnshaw and Heathcliff, making it a compelling read for anyone interested in the complexities of forbidden love.

#8 The Scarlet Letter

Extension: PDF | 291 pages

The Scarlet Letter by Nathaniel Hawthorne explores themes of sin, guilt, and societal condemnation in 17th-century Puritan Boston. It powerfully portrays the forbidden love and its consequences, making it a timeless classic.
